Myeloperoxidase (MPO) is a heme-containing peroxidase enzyme encoded by the MPO gene and is one of the most abundant proteins stored in the azurophilic granules of neutrophils. MPO plays a central role in innate immune defense by catalyzing the production of reactive oxidant species during the respiratory burst of activated phagocytes. Through its catalytic activity, MPO converts hydrogen peroxide and chloride ions into hypochlorous acid, a potent antimicrobial oxidant capable of destroying engulfed microorganisms.
Myeloperoxidase antibody, also referred to as MPO antibody or myeloid peroxidase antibody in the literature, detects a granule-associated enzyme that is highly enriched in neutrophils and present in monocytes and immature myeloid precursors. Because MPO expression is strongly associated with granulocytic lineage cells, the protein is widely used as a marker for identifying neutrophils and studying inflammatory infiltrates in tissues. Within neutrophils, MPO is stored in cytoplasmic azurophilic granules and released during cell activation and degranulation. In addition to microbial killing, MPO-derived oxidants contribute to inflammatory signaling and oxidative modification of biological molecules. These oxidative reactions can influence immune regulation as well as tissue injury during chronic inflammation. As a result, MPO has been widely studied in disease processes including cardiovascular disease, autoimmune disorders, infection, and tumor-associated inflammation.

Optimal dilution of the MPO Antibody Rabbit Monoclonal MPO/8631R should be determined by the researcher.
A recombinant fragment of human MPO protein was used as the immunogen for the MPO antibody.
Aliquot the MPO antibody and store frozen at -20oC or colder. Avoid repeated freeze-thaw cycles.
